What is tech accounting?

A Tech Accounting job involves applying accounting principles to technology-related financial transactions, ensuring compliance with regulations and industry standards. Professionals in this role handle software revenue recognition, capitalizing software development costs, and understanding financial implications of cloud computing and subscription-based models. They work closely with finance, engineering, and legal teams to align accounting practices with business operations. Strong knowledge of GAAP, ASC 606, and financial reporting is essential.

What does a tech accountant do?

A professional in Tech Accounting typically manages tasks such as analyzing revenue models specific to technology companies, preparing financial statements, ensuring compliance with accounting standards, and reconciling complex data sets. You may frequently collaborate with engineering, product, and sales teams to understand project costs, recognize revenue appropriately, and align on financial goals. Regular duties also include supporting audits, optimizing accounting processes through technology, and staying current with evolving financial regulations in the tech industry. This dynamic environment provides the opportunity to work both independently and as part of a team, building a strong foundation for career grow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in tech accounting?

To thrive in Tech Accounting, you need a strong background in accounting principles, analytical skills, and familiarity with technology sector financial reporting, often supported by a degree in accounting or finance and relevant certifications such as CPA. Proficiency in specialized accounting software (e.g., NetSuite, SAP), Excel, and knowledge of financial regulations pertaining to technology companies are highly desirable. Excellent probl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you manage complex data and work cross-functionally. These abilities are vital for ensuring accuracy in financial reporting, compliance, and supporting the fast-paced growth of tech organizations.

What is a tech accountant?

A tech accountant is a professional who combines accounting skills with knowledge of technology, often working with financial software, data analysis tools, and automation systems to improve financial processes. They may also be involved in implementing or managing accounting systems and ensuring data security within tech-driven environments.

Job Description
Accounting Clerk
Primary Purpose: This position exists to own the accounts payable function by reviewing, processing, and analyzing the company's operating expense structure and applying that financial insight and analysis to the monthly close and financial reporting processes.
Measures of Success
  • Ability to Take Ownership, Be Transparent, Take the High Road, and Celebrate Small Successes.
  • Ability to take ownership of the accounts payable process.
  • Ability to perform balance sheet and expense reconciliations and analysis.

Accounting Clerk Key Roles & Responsibilities
Accounts Payable
  • At all times act as the point of contact for vendors regarding invoicing and payment.
  • Review and process and invoices for payment.
  • Act as a liaison between the store-level business operations group and the Vendors.

Month-End Close Process
  • Perform balance sheet reconciliations and book adjusting journal entries as necessary.
  • Provide analyses of expense variances.
  • Produce month-end workpapers to address specific financial results/metrics to be used as part of the monthly financial reporting package.

Other Accounting Responsibilities
  • Monthly invoice reviews
  • Month-end bank activity analysis
  • Aging Exception analysis
  • Bank reconciliation
  • Support quarterly and annual audit efforts by performing research and providing documentation as appropriate.

Accounting Clerk - Candidate Profile
Minimum Qualifications
  • Strong general accounting knowledge
  • Well versed in using MS Excel
  • Commitment to financial prudence and accounting diligence
  • A history of success in a team environment
  • Ability to utilize technology and programs to drive efficiency and stay current with our technology training
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ills (email, web, phone, in-person)
  • Strong, creative problem-solving skills
  • Ability to take initiative and think critically to identify improvement opportunities
  • Ability to take ownership of the details - large and small
  • Decision making that demonstrates good judgment
  • Clean motor vehicle record and criminal background record
